Abstract
Monolithic microwave mixers, operating at 2-3 GHz, have been developed based on the lumped balanced circuit approach. By using two passive l umped balun circuits on the RF and LO ports, respectively, a wideband balanced mixer with good isolation can be realized. The conversion los s, under the IF at 200 MHz condition, was 12-14 dB at a LO power of 11 dBm. In addition, this mixer demonstrated an input IP3 of 18.9 dBm at 2.4 GHz. The simulated results, based on the large-signal models, pre sented a fair agreement with the measured results, which reveals the i mportance of device modeling. (C) 1998 John Wiley & Sons, Inc.
